Common Welding Qualifications

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s normal Certified Welder card helps make you eligible for most positions, many fields will require their certain certificate. Examples of the most-well-known of these appear below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for those that deal with boiler and pressurized containers
  • CW Certification to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for those that work on pipelines in the gas and oil industry
  • CWI and SCWI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ors

Welding Specialist Courses – What to Anticipate

The author of this post cannot say which of the certified welding schools is right for you, yet we can present you with the following tips and hints that may make your choice a bit easier. The first step in getting started with a position as a welder is to decide which of the leading brazing programs will be right for you. Prior to signing a commitment with the you’ve selected, it’s strongly suggested that you take the time to check the certification status of the training course with the AWS. If your course is endorsed by these bodies, you might additionally want to evaluate some other things like:

  • Be certain the school trains on equipment that meets present trade specifications
  • See if the college supplies financial assistance
  • Make certain the college’s program features courses in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
  • Choose schools that cover AWS SENSE standards
